Sydney Sweeney is calling out critics of her bathwater soap collab. In an interview with the Wall Street Journal, which was published on Aug. 20, the 'Anyone But You' star explained why she felt like there was hypocrisy in the backlash she received for announcing her collab with men's personal care brand Dr. Squatch in May to sell bars of soap infused with her 'actual bathwater.' 'It was mainly the girls making comments about it, which I thought was really interesting,' she told WSJ. 'They all loved the idea of Jacob Elordi's bathwater,' she noted, referencing to the 2023 film 'Saltburn.'

The first wave of reactions for The Long Walk has landed, and if the early praise is any indication, we're looking at one of the strongest Stephen King adaptations to date. Directed by Francis Lawrence ( The Hunger Games franchise), this chilling and emotionally loaded dystopian thriller is hitting audiences right in the gut. Based on King's first written novel, The Long Walk tells the story of a cruel annual event where 50 teenage boys are forced to walk non-stop across a dystopian America. If their speed drops below three miles per hour, they're executed on the spot. There's no resting, no turning back, only walking until one is left standing. That survivor wins and will never have to worry about anything again. Critics are calling The Long Walk 'brutal,' 'soul-wrenching,' and 'one of the best Stephen King adaptations' ever made. They've praised the film's intense emotional weight, its shocking moments, and the powerful chemistry between leads Cooper Hoffman and David Jonsson. Many described it as 'visceral,' 'gripping,' and 'unforgettable'. While fans of King know how hit-or-miss his book adaptations can be, Lawrence appears to have cracked the code here. Social media is lighting up with overwhelmingly positive reactions after the first screening. This adaptation has been a long time coming. Over the years, directors like George A. Romero and Frank Darabont tried to bring the story to life but never made it across the finish line. Now, Lawrence, working from a script by JT Mollner, has finally delivered. The cast features Cooper Hoffman, David Jonsson, Garrett Wareing, Tut Nyuot, Charlie Plummer, Ben Wang, Roman Griffin Davis, Jordan Gonzalez, Joshua Odjick, Josh Hamilton, with Judy Greer and Mark Hamill rounding things out. Hamill takes on the chilling role of the Major, and he's credited Mike Flanagan for nudging him into darker territory. According to the cast, they walked close to 300 miles during filming to capture the true physical and emotional toll of the story. The Long Walk opens in theaters on September 12

DJ Khaled has partnered with Rewind It 10, a beard dye brand launched by Carolyn and Jeff Aronson and Fat Joe, turning personal grooming into a message of confidence and business growth. Opinions expressed by Entrepreneur contributors are their own. Social media puts every aspect of our appearance under a microscope, and insecurities are more visible than ever. You're not just worried about coworkers noticing a bald spot or a grey patch — everyone can see everything about you online. But as any savvy entrepreneur knows, small problems can spark big opportunities. Rewind It 10, a beard dye brand, is capitalizing on that very tension. By partnering with music and entertainment mogul DJ Khaled, the brand is turning a confidence crisis into a growth strategy — boosting self-assurance for customers while driving its bottom line. All he does is win The best celebrity partnerships happen organically, and this one is no exception. Khaled was already a Rewind It 10 customer before he became a spokesman, using the product regularly. "I use this product every day — especially when I get a haircut," he says. "Back when we were making it, they let me test it out, and they even gave me one to use before my official box was ready." He likens the dye to a favorite cereal or sneaker — something you reach for without thinking twice. But for Khaled, the product itself is only part of the draw. What really attracted him to Rewind It 10 was the team behind it. The brand was launched in October 2023 by beauty mogul Carolyn Aronson, entrepreneur Jeff Aronson and Khaled's fellow music mogul Fat Joe. "Fat Joe is my brother," Khaled says. "He's supported me since day one, so when he brought me the chance to help sell a product I already love, it was a no-brainer." Khaled also has deep respect for the Aronsons and the empire they've built in hair care, calling Carolyn "the queen." Carolyn, a Puerto Rican-born entrepreneur, turned her experience as a hairstylist and salon owner into a global brand. She founded It's a 10 Haircare in 2005, best known for its Miracle Leave-In product, and has grown it into a $500 million-a-year powerhouse. Her husband, Jeff, serves as CEO and president, bringing leadership experience from roles including Titan Fighting Championships and Arco Property Management. He joined It's a 10 in 2017, helping scale the brand alongside Carolyn's vision. "What they've built is a winning team," the All I Do is Win rapper says. "And I believe winners should work with winners, and create more winners." So far, Khaled's beard dye has lived up to the standard he set with that 2010 hit, becoming the best-seller in Rewind's celebrity ambassador line, which also includes Travis Kelce.
